role you will contribute: /n /n/n /n Performs Nuclear
Medicine/PET/CT Imaging studies. Handles, administers, calculates
dosage and prepares Radionuclide. Maintains records in accordance
with departmental policy and procedures as well as within state
requirements. Performs basic patient care within scope of practice
and to departmental standards. Responsibility to adhere to the
AdventHealth compliance plan, to the rules and regulations of all
local, state, and Federal agencies, and to the standards of all
accrediting bodies. /n /n/n /n The value you will bring to the
team: /n /n/n /n PRINCIPAL DUTIES AND JOB RESPONSIBILITIES : /n
/n/n /n/n /n - Performs Nuclear Medicine and PET/CT Imaging
studies. Positions patient and equipment, changes collimators,
selects technical factor and processes data to produce images
meeting Radiologist standards, in a safe and timely manner. /n /n -
Handles, administers, calculates dosage and prepares Radionuclides
as required. /n /n - Maintains records in accordance with
departmental policy and procedures as well as within state
requirements. /n /n - Processes images with correct patient
demographic and examination information. Submits images, with
adequate clinical information for review by Radiologist, as
appropriate. /n /n - Uses computer to maintain radioactive material
records as well as quality assurance records, disposal records as
required by department policy and State regulations. /n /n -
Maintains radioactive materials records as well as quality
assurance records, disposal records as required by department
policy and State regulations. /n /n - Operates all equipment and
uses Radioactive Materials in a safe and effective manner, with
proper attention to radiation, electrical and mechanical safety. /n
/n - Performs direct patient care duties within technologist’s
scope of practice. Utilizes proper infection control and BSI
techniques. /n /n - Performs basic patient care, including
monitoring of patient condition, caring for patient comfort,
safety, and privacy. /n /n - Performs basic equipment maintenance,
coordinating service calls as required. /n /n/n /n/n /n
Qualifications /n /n The expertise and experiences you’ll need to
succeed: /n /n/n /n KNOWLEDGE AND SKILLS REQUIRED: /n /n/n /n ·
Graduate of an A.R.R.T. or N.M.T.C.B approved program /n /n/n /n ·
Current State of Florida Department of Health Nuclear Medicine
license. /n /n/n /n · A.R.R.T or N.M.T.C.B. registration /n /n/n /n
· Must be able to move, operate and properly use all Nuclear
Medicine equipment and camera’s including computers, collimators,
color printers, survey meters, dose calibrators, dose management
computer system, Cerner HIS system and Agfa PACS system. /n /n/n /n
· Must be able to independently perform Nuclear Medicine procedures
to Radiologists’ and Cardiologists’ standards. /n /n/n /n · Must be
able to use computer system for data entry and retrieval. /n /n/n
/n · Patient care and communication skills to deal with patients
from infant through geriatric age groups. /n /n/n /n · Basic
clerical skills as needed for record keeping and documentation /n
/n/n /n · Mature judgment is frequently required in dealing with
patients, public, physicians and co-workers. /n /n/n /n · Must be
able to adjust workload as needed due to emergency studies
scheduled. /n /n/n /n · Calm careful behavior is necessary when
dealing with situations such as critically ill patients or in the
event of a “code” or other emergency. /n /n/n /n · Any significant
change in patient condition required accurate judgment with
appropriate actions. /n /n/n /n · Must be able to act properly in
case of a radioactive Material contamination, emergency or
disaster. /n /n/n /n · Technologist must be able to exercise
independent judgment in assessment of exam quality, patient
conditions and need for repeat images or variance from routine. /n
/n/n /n · Must be able to assess and maintain workflow in Nuclear
Medicine. /n /n/n /n · Must use proper judgment regarding need for
communication regarding patient care, workflow or other issues /n
/n/n /n · Newly graduated technologist should be able to work
unattended shift, with only occasional guidance needed within six
months. /n /n/n /n · Experienced technologist should be able to
work independently in one month. /n /n/n /n KNOWLEDGE AND SKILLS
